Cash Account. (a) The Client hereby establishes and shall maintain with the Custodian a Cash Account to be used in connection with transactions relating to the Securities. The collected balance from time to time in the Cash Account shall constitute "Cash". Any credit made to the Cash Account shall be provisional and may be reversed if such payment is not actually collected or received. (b) Except as otherwise provided by law, the Cash Account (including subdivisions maintained in different currencies, including Composite Currency Units) shall constitute one single and indivisible current account. Consequently, the Custodian has the right, among others, of transferring the balance of any subaccount of the Cash Account to any other subaccount at any time and without prior notice. (c) The Custodian may in accordance with customary practice hold any currency (other than Belgian Francs) or Composite Currency Unit in which any subdivision of the Cash Account is denominated on deposit in, and effect transactions relating thereto through, an account (a "Foreign Account") with a Xxxxxx Affiliate or another bank in the country where such currency is the lawful currency or in other countries where such currency or Composite Currency Unit may be lawfully held on deposit. (d) The Custodian shall have no liability for any loss or damage arising from the applicability of any law or regulation now or hereafter in effect, or from the occurrence of any event, which may affect the transferability, convertibility, or availability of any currency (other than Belgian Francs) or Composite Currency Unit in the countries where such Foreign Accounts are maintained and in no event shall the Custodian be obligated to substitute another currency for a currency (including a currency that is a component of a Composite Currency Unit) whose transferability, convertibility or availability has been affected by such law, regulation or event. To the extent that any such law, regulation or event imposes a cost or charge upon the Custodian in relation to the transferability, convertibility, or availability of any such currency or Composite Currency Unit, such cost or charge shall be for the account of the Client. If pursuant to any such law or regulation, or as a result of any such event, the Custodian cannot deal in any component currency of a Composite Currency Unit or effect a particular transaction in a Composite Currency Unit on behalf of the Client, the Custodian may thereafter treat any account denominated in an affected Composite Currency Unit as a group of separate accounts denominated in the relevant component currencies. (e) Transactions in a currency or Composite Currency Unit shall be subject to the regulations laid down by the exchange control authorities of Belgium and of the country where such currency (or component currency) is the lawful currency or where such currency or Composite Currency Unit is held on deposit.
